In response to the video. This doesn't prove that its not a tough trans. If they had a recall and were supposed to replace the trans then it was obviously shipped with a faulty trans. Not a weak trans but a clear fault in the way they originally built it.
It wont be common practice to sell any of these cars with the faulty trans.
I worked for Mercedes for 10 years. We had plenty of cars with internal type of recalls that would have broken on the street had we not fixed it before it was delivered. Consider it kind of part of the original build of the car.
